Viggle AI has secured nearly $26 million CAD in Series A funding to fuel its platform's growth. The startup plans to use the capital to develop a stronger model, add new capabilities, and improve user experience.

Viggle AI is a Toronto-based generative artificial intelligence startup that specializes in creating videos from simple text and image prompts. Its technology gained popularity through a viral meme format involving celebrity video edits. The startup aims to provide a unique, controllable video generation experience, differentiating itself from existing pixel-based models. Viggle's platform supports various users, from casual meme creators to professionals in animation and game design.
